Waters of Wabash Skilled Nursing Facility East the
1900 N Alber St · Wabash, IN · 46992 · 2605637427
84 certified beds For profit - Limited Liability company Chain: Infinity Healthcare Consulting
Why this verdict
- Inspection record is far worse than the national median (deficiency count and severity).
- Inspection results are getting worse cycle over cycle, not better.
- No federal fines or payment denials in CMS’s 3-year window.

CMS ratings & staffing
Overall: 1 of 5 Inspections: 1 of 5 Staffing: 1 of 5 Quality measures: 4 of 5
| Total nurse hours / resident-day | 3.15 | 3.48 min · 4.1 strong |
|---|---|---|
| RN hours / resident-day | 0.30 | 0.55–0.75 |
| Weekend hours / resident-day | 2.84 | ≈ weekday level |
| Nursing turnover / year | 31% | median 45% |
| Fines (3-yr window) | none |
